Output e926c6cea528c669108ca244fb386c3717e0d505c8bf31b0c4d0d6744e04ce55:8

value
23619827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ac0433849ceb10d60abaf276c5fc9d2abab144 OP_EQUAL
address
MQZ3HFdgHCDbWxutzPVFTLA8Dawe7tZ9ZE
transaction
e926c6cea528c669108ca244fb386c3717e0d505c8bf31b0c4d0d6744e04ce55
spent
true